Output 514888e8d24fcdaaab7534f911c7f1da162ad81181107d67d2d63a828da610a9:0

value
26210566
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1730a7abd8aec0224180dcd58aaccc5f103f4fca OP_EQUALVERIFY OP_CHECKSIG
address
137cq24tc34ZDLPMUAp8gQYBpr3TMzzLxh
transaction
514888e8d24fcdaaab7534f911c7f1da162ad81181107d67d2d63a828da610a9
spent
true